Company Description
Dredging is one of our traditional core activities, and Boskalis is famous for projects like the land reclamation for Manila International Airport, Pulau Tekong, Singapore’s first polder, or the expansion of the Suez Canal. Creation of new nature areas like the Markerwadden is something we contribute to. In your job, you will work for the dredging division. Boskalis has been protecting coastlines, reclaiming land, and developing infrastructure for over 100 years. That’s a lot of ingenuity, talent, and commitment. Within Boskalis, craftsmanship is crucial to our operations. This craftsmanship is supported by our Academies in both the Offshore and Dredging Divisions. Here, we develop specialized learning programs specifically tailored to the knowledge and skills required for the activities of various business units, for all colleagues working worldwide on our ships, in offices, and on offshore and dredging projects.
The Academies work directly together within Boskalis and with the central L&D department. We are driven by craftsmanship, talent development, safety, and quality. We can only deliver a high-quality product if we continue to learn, share, adapt, improve, and change continuously. The principle within Boskalis is workplace learning (70-20-10) supported by expert colleagues, trainers, and digital learning tools such as e-learning and simulators.
In recent years, the Academies have been further developed, and various training and digital learning solutions are already facilitated for different (international) target groups. To strengthen both Academies, we are looking for new colleagues to build further together.
